NEW - Doka beam XT20 with extra load capacity!

The Doka beam XT20 impresses with its extra load-bearing capacity. Installed in wall and floor formwork systems, its additional strength means less material consumption. This saves time and reduces costs on the construction site.

With its low weight of just 5 kg/lin. m, the XT20 beam ensures ergonomic working. The proven height of 20 cm is ideal for use with existing accessories. The top beam end reinforcement offers reliable protection against splintering and moisture.

Product features:

  • Extra load-bearing timber formwork beam in the proven construction height of 20 cm
  • Can be used in beam-floor and beam-wall formwork systems
  • Top-beam-end reinforcement as reliable protection against splintering and moisture
  • Support bar made of high-quality plywood with grey bar coating
  • Beams marked in 50-cm increment-grid
  • 2 system holes at each beam end
  • Notch for chalk line
  • Labelling on belt width and bar; Optional: Customising possible
  • Officially approved by the DIBt (Approval: Z-9.01-920)

Technical Data:

  • Moment(M): 7,0 kNm
  • Shear force (Q): 15,0 kN (16,5 kN)*
  • Rigidity (EI): 585 kNm²
  • Weight: 5,0 kg/lin. m

* According to approval Z-9.1-920, the permissible shear force may be assumed to be 16.5 kN if the permissible support force of 30 kN is complied with.
